Output 83c7d66ee16af980b82f1c9a9ec232c91d81fc7040a57d6e331f2a5d18729fa4:0
- value
- 66728703
- script pubkey
- OP_0 OP_PUSHBYTES_20 b89bb1d1ebb8512d0af60cd981444e03407a4f15
- address
- bc1qhzdmr50thpgj6zhkpnvcz3zwqdq85nc4uah7q4
- transaction
- 83c7d66ee16af980b82f1c9a9ec232c91d81fc7040a57d6e331f2a5d18729fa4